<h2>Meet Foobi</h2>
<p>Foobi greets you with a beautiful opening screen unveiling the app itself.</p>
<div class="wp-caption alignnone" style="width: 330px"><img title="Launching Foobi"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2631/4090363822_b877bbf2a3_o.jpg" alt="Launching Foobi" width="320" height="480"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Launching Foobi</p></div>
<p>Whenever you consumed a category of food, launch Foobi, flick the screen left or right to choose the type of food, tap &#8220;+&#8221; to add a serving to the record.</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2787/4089600479_eb7f1339e6_o.jpg" alt="" width="320" height="480" /></p>
<p>Clicking the 3 stripes button on the left lets you take a quick glance at your diet for today or any date that you select:</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2467/4089601371_3c4c9371a0_o.jpg" alt="" width="320" height="480" /></p>
<p>For Foobi to be useful, you need to tracking your diet daily. Overtime, weekly summaries of your diet will be displayed on a graph. To see the graph, just flip your iPhone / iPod Touch into landscape mode.</p>
<p>As you can see from the graph below, I have been eating more meat (red) than vegetables (green).</p>
<p>If you have been wanting to eat more vegetables than meat, this graph will tell you you&#8217;ve been doing otherwise.</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2666/4089673251_7f072c08d5_o.jpg" alt="" width="480" height="320" /></p>
<h2>Planning Your Diet</h2>
<p>Foobi is great for planning diets. In order to have a well balanced diet, you need to consume more of this and less of that. How do you know how much of what you&#8217;ve already consumed? By using Foobi to track your daily servings, it is easy to maintain a well balanced diet.</p>
<p>To plan your diet, simply go to Settings by clicking the &#8220;i&#8221; icon on the bottom right.</p>
<p>From here, you can set a daily servings limit for each food category or change the category name. If you don&#8217;t like the name &#8220;Poultry&#8221;, you can name it &#8220;Birds&#8221;. <img src='http://www.suberapps.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_biggrin.gif' alt=':D'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p><img class="alignnone"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2718/4089601793_8889ac2033_o.jpg" alt="" width="320" height="480" /></p>
<p>If you can&#8217;t find a category from the default list, you can add your own. You can also change the color label of the food category, for example vegetables would most logically be green, not red! By using the right color to label your food category, it&#8217;ll be easier to read your weekly consumption graph.</p>

<h2>Gameplay</h2>
<div class="wp-caption alignnone" style="width: 330px"><img title="Tap the correct song"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2639/4084342964_8c70a43e05_o.jpg" alt="Tap the correct song" width="320" height="480"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Tap the correct song</p></div>
<p>Basically Jukebox tests you on your entire music collection. It plays a a random portion of a song for a few seconds and you&#8217;re suppose to choose the right title from a list of four.</p>
<p>Sounds simple, but the longer you play, the more nervous you will become. Jukebox progresses on a relatively fast speed leaving you no time for dilly dally which increases the challenge. This game actually gave me an adrenaline rush. With each incorrect song I chose, it made me want to play on and choose more correct ones to increase my score percentage.</p>
<h2 style="font-size: 1.5em;">Scoring System</h2>
<div class="wp-caption alignnone" style="width: 330px"><img title="Your Statistics" src="http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2544/4083913057_662c143dda_o.jpg" alt="Your Statistics" width="320" height="480" /><p class="wp-caption-text">Your Statistics</p></div>
<p>One good thing about this game is that whenever you end the game, your current score will be accumulated as a total score under &#8216;Statistics&#8217;. When viewing your statistics, your results will be optionally uploaded to Swipe Interactive&#8217;s servers which will in return your &#8216;World Ranking&#8217; score.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s pretty interesting to see how well you fair compared to players around the world, a good incentive to keep on playing.</p>

<h2 style="clear: both">The Laid-Back Todo List</h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/put_things_off.jpg" alt="" width="586" height="437"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/>We have seen way too many feature packed &#8216;to-do&#8217; lists apps on the App Store. Having lots of functions in an app of this genre works for some people but there are also people I know who cannot be bothered with the GTD system, the hassle of syncing with a desktop counterpart, sub grouping tasks and so on.</p>
<p style="clear: both">This group of people only need something as simple as a &#8220;pencil and paper&#8221; type of system. Only needing a place to quickly pen what they need to do.</p>
<p style="clear: both">Put Things Off fulfills this beautifully with a cute wooden interface coupled with subtle sounds to compliment the experience. Using this is a joy, it kinda makes me feel happy using it, mainly due to the light hearted design.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ong>Launching The App</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/pto_splash.jpg" alt="" width="306" height="460" align="left" />Launching the app greets you with a wooden background and the name of the app.</p>
<p>I am not a fan of splash screens as most of them I&#8217;ve seen are outright ugly and inconsistent with the app itself.</p>
<p>This one makes me a little more forgiving because of its consistency and it&#8217;s lovely laid back design.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ong>Interface And Function</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/pto_userinterface1.jpg" alt="" width="306" height="460" align="left" />Using the app is extremely straightforward. Can&#8217;t get any simpler than that:</p>
<p>Tap the &#8216;+&#8217; icon and add your tasks right away! Whatever you have added lands in your Inbox, ready for you to file to other boxes of different context.</p>
<p>There are only 3 boxes for you to file your tasks:</p>
<p>1. Today (tasks you need to complete today)<br />
2. Put Off (tasks you will complete later)<br />
3. Done (completed tasks)</p>
<p>Very straightforward and logical. This simple way of organizing tasks gets you up to speed very quickly. It doesn&#8217;t force you to learn and adjust to complicated systems.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ong>Navigating Around</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/pto_userinterface2.jpg" alt="" width="306" height="458" align="left" />Navigating to other sections is only a matter of taping on the other boxes at the bottom.</p>
<p>You can move your tasks around or delete them as you wish.</p>
<p>Once you&#8217;re done with any tasks, just tap the &#8220;tick&#8221; icon.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="tweetmeme_button" style="float: right; margin-right: 10px;"><a href="http://api.tweetmeme.com/share?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F05%2Fplain-clip-remove-text-formatting%2F"><img src="http://api.tweetmeme.com/imagebutton.gif?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F05%2Fplain-clip-remove-text-formatting%2F" height="61" width="51" /></a></div><p style="clear: both"><a class="image-link" href="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/plain-clip-thumb.jpg"><img class="linked-to-original" style="margin: 0pt 10px 10px 0pt; display: inline;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/plain-clip-thumb-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="275" align="left" /></a><br style="clear: both" />I believe most of us have the same gripe about copying text and pasting it onto another application but not wanting the formatting to be pasted as well.</p>
<p style="clear: both">There are many ways to strip text of it&#8217;s formatting, eg. pasting text into Text Edit, selecting &#8220;Make Plain Text&#8221; from the top menu, copy the text and pasting it into your desired application. Or pasting the formatted text into your browser&#8217;s address bar, select all and copy the text again before pasting the text into your desired application.</p>
<p style="clear: both">All these takes a number of steps and all these time adds up to cause annoyance, here&#8217;s an easier way to strip text formatting, meet <a title="Plain Clip" href="http://www.bluem.net/en/mac/plain-clip/" target="_blank">Plain Clip</a> (Free).</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ong><br />
Faceless Application</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">Plain Clip is a faceless application, meaning there is no user interface, you install it on your Mac, the next time you copy a formatted text, you only need to launch this program to remove it&#8217;s formatting. What happens behind the background is that when Plain Clip launches, it strips the currently copied text on the clipboard of it&#8217;s formatting and closes itself. So that you can paste the currently copied text in it&#8217;s unformatted glory.</p>
<p style="clear: both">If you&#8217;re using an application launcher program like <a title="QuickSilver " href="http://www.blacktree.com/" target="_blank">QuickSilver</a> or <a title="LaunchBar" href="http://www.obdev.at/products/launchbar/beta.html" target="_blank">LaunchBar</a>, the process of stripping formatted text is even faster.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ong><br />
Using TextExpander with Plain Clip</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">But here&#8217;s the quickest way. This will require to be a proud owner of <a title="TextExpander" href="http://www.smileonmymac.com/TextExpander/" target="_blank">TextExpander</a> ($29.95). For those of you who have no idea what TextExpander is, it&#8217;s a Mac app that expands your pre-defined text snippets, images or both by typing an abbreviation. More info about TextExpander in <a title="http://www.suberapps.com/2008/11/23/5-essential-mac-apps-for-shortcut-fans/" href="http://www.suberapps.com/2008/11/23/5-essential-mac-apps-for-shortcut-fans/" target="_blank">this post</a>.</p>
<p style="clear: both">Here&#8217;s what you need to do:</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/textexpander-applescript-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="490" height="176" align="left" /></p>
<ol style="clear: both">
<li>Create a new snippet</li>
<li>Paste this into the snippet field: <strong>d</strong><strong>o shell script &#8220;&#8216;/Applications/Plain Clip.app/pc&#8217; -v&#8221;</strong></li>
<li>Select &#8220;Applescript&#8221; as the content:</li>
<li>Assign an abbreviation to your snippet, eg. ;pc (pc is for Plain Clip, so it&#8217;s easy to remember, you can use your own abbreviation of course)</li>
</ol>
<p>The next time you need to copy a chunk of formatted text, type &#8220;;pc&#8221; and voila! You pasted text will be unformatted. The fastest way to un-format and paste text at the same time. <img src='http://www.suberapps.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':)'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="tweetmeme_button" style="float: right; margin-right: 10px;"><a href="http://api.tweetmeme.com/share?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F03%2Fstuf-unobstrusive-low-footprint-clipboard-manager%2F"><img src="http://api.tweetmeme.com/imagebutton.gif?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F03%2Fstuf-unobstrusive-low-footprint-clipboard-manager%2F" height="61" width="51" /></a></div><p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/stuf-clipboard-manager-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="584" height="389" align="left" />I&#8217;ve tried countless clipboard managers, though most of them are useful, but all of them have one or two things in common, they&#8217;re either &#8220;obtrusive&#8221; or have a high memory footprint. What I meant by obtrusive is that they cannot be hidden completely, letting you only hide the clipboard at the left/right/top/bottom of your screen with a little bit of the app jutting out of the screen, visible to the eye. That&#8217;s not very elegant.</p>
<p style="clear: both"><a title="Stuf" href="http://www.theescapers.com/stuf/" target="_blank">Stuf</a> (£12.99), written by <a title="The Escapers" href="http://www.theescapers.com/" target="_blank">The Escapers</a> is simple and gets the job done. Utilizing Leopard&#8217;s new Heads Up Display technology, also known as the HUD, not only does the user interface look like part of your Mac, it&#8217;s also easy on your system&#8217;s memory resources which is an important aspect especially if you have many programs open at the same time and already eating up lots of system resources.</p>
<p style="clear: both">Clipboard managers are useful if you find yourself copying text, images or both, and needing them all over again just to realise that you&#8217;ve over-written your clipboard with a newly copied item. As a web developer I find that this is a very useful tool to boost my productivity as I&#8217;m dealing with codes and snippets everyday.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ong><br />
Stuf User Interface</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/stuf-user-interface-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="586" height="439"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/>This is the HUD window and this is all there is to the app other than the preferences window. I&#8217;ve set the background of the HUD window to white for my liking, of course you can change the text and background to whatever color you want via the preference window:</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/stuf-preferences-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="497" height="459"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">You can also create multiple clipboards so that you can store certain snippets that you might want to use in future.</p>
<h2><strong><br />
Bring up Stuf via Hotkey</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/stuf-hotkey-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="497" height="459"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/>What is vital for every clipboard manager is that it has to be hidden from view when you don&#8217;t need it but lets you call up the app easily via a hotkey when you do. From the preference window, you can set your own custom hot key. I set it to &#8220;alt + S&#8221; in this instance. &#8220;S&#8221; stands for Stuf, so it&#8217;s easy to remember.</p>
<h2 style="clear: both"><strong><br />
Clipboard Sharing</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/stuf-clipboard-sharing-thumb.jpg" alt="" width="497" height="459"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/>If you have multiple Macs and would like to have a synchronized set of clipboard items, this feature is nifty.</p>
<p style="clear: both">To conclude, Stuf succeeds in both form and function, although it lacks the option of pasting unformatted text which I find very useful in other clipboard manager programs.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="tweetmeme_button" style="float: right; margin-right: 10px;"><a href="http://api.tweetmeme.com/share?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F01%2F12-useful-mac-apps-to-rock-your-itunes%2F"><img src="http://api.tweetmeme.com/imagebutton.gif?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.suberapps.com%2F2009%2F04%2F01%2F12-useful-mac-apps-to-rock-your-itunes%2F" height="61" width="51" /></a></div><p style="clear: both">iTunes is a great software to manage and listen to our music, but the experience can be further improved by using additional plugins or apps. These plugins / apps basically extends the functionality of iTunes, enhances iTunes, or both, to satisfy some of the needs that iTunes cannot provide.</p>
<p style="clear: both">Here are 12 plugins / apps that you will find useful when used with iTunes.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2 style="clear: both">Cover Stream</h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$20 | <a title="CoverStream" href="http://coverstream.net/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/coverstream2-thumb.png" alt="" width="583" height="262"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/>Cover Stream puts coverflow into a HUD window that you can summon with a pre-defined hot key. You can browse your music library and control music easily in that window without having to use iTunes to do that. Cover Stream also integrates with Last.fm flawlessly, scrobbing your music while you listen to them.</p>
<h2><strong><br />
CoverSutra</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$20 | <a title="CoverSutra" href="http://www.sophiestication.com/coversutra/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/coversutra1-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="360"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/>CoverSutra is one of the most mature and popular app to control your iTunes music without switching to iTunes. The app features one of the best user inteface design, using the app is a real pleasure. With CoverSutra, you can search music, see the currently played song&#8217;s  album art on your desktop. Integration with Last.fm is also one of the feature.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
GimmeSomeTune</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[Free | <a title="GimmeSomeTune" href="http://www.eternalstorms.at/gimmesometune/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/gimmesometune-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="329"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">Truly one of the most essential app to compliment your iTunes. GimmeSomeTune fetches missing coverarts and lyrics in the background while you listen to your music. I have tried many coverart and lyrics fetching apps and I must say this is one that really gets both the job done well. The best part is, it&#8217;s free.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
Bowtie</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[Free | <a title="Bowtie" href="http://bowtieapp.com/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/bowtie-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="315"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">Designed by <a title="Laurent Baumann" href="http://lbaumann.com/" target="_blank">Laurent Baumann</a>, also responsible for <a title="Fontcase" href="http://www.bohemiancoding.com/fontcase" target="_blank">Fontcase</a>, Bowtie is a beautifully designed free iTunes controller that allows you control your iTunes music unobstrusively. You can also put the now playing song&#8217;s coverart on your desktop. Bowtie also features downloadable themes for the CD Cover that houses the coverart which you can start by downloading the themes <a title="Bowtie Themes" href="http://macthemes2.net/forum/viewtopic.php?id=16790844" target="_blank">here</a>.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
Tangerine</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$24.95 | <a title="Tangerine" href="http://www.potionfactory.com/tangerine/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/tangerine-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="150"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">Designed by Potion Factory, also behind <a title="The Hit List Review" href="http://www.suberapps.com/2009/01/12/is-the-hit-list-better-than-things-gtd-app/" target="_blank">The Hit List</a>, Tangerine analyses the tempo of your music and lets you easily create playlists of music grouped by it&#8217;s tempo among many other options. Great app if you hate the idea of manually choosing songs for your next workout etc.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
Awaken</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$15 | <a title="Awaken" href="http://embraceware.com/products/awaken/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/awaken-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="277"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">Awaken lets you play music when you&#8217;re sleeping, sleeps your Mac utilizing a sleep timer, and wakes you and your Mac up with your favourite music. You can also use Awaken to alert you about anything else other than waking you up by using the egg timer. Control the alarm and sleep timer with your Apple Remote from across the room while running Awaken in fullscreen mode.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
CoverScout</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$40 | <a title="CoverScout" href="http://www.equinux.com/us/products/coverscout/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/coverscout-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="332"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">CoverScout scours the internet for coverarts and adds it to your albums. The neat part is that you can edit your coverarts by rotating, cropping, scaling, straightening and even adjusting the color levels of the image.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
SongGenie</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$33 | <a title="SongGenie" href="http://www.equinux.com/us/products/songgenie/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/songgenie-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="313"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">SongGenie aids you in filling in missing meta datas of your tracks like descriptions, artist names, track names, album names etc, making your iTunes library much more useful and tidy. Written by the same developers from CoverScout, SongGenie integrates with CoverScout by assigning the tasks of adding album arts to your tracks to CoverScout with just one click.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
TuneUp</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[$29.95 or $19.95 yearly | <a title="TuneUp" href="http://www.tuneupmedia.com/mac/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/tuneup-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="335"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both"><strong>UPDATE (Discount for SUBERAPPS readers)<br />
</strong></p>
<p style="clear: both">TuneUp is offering a 15% discount promo code for SUBERAPPS readers, just enter SUBERAPPS during checkout, valid till 15 April 09.</p>
<p style="clear: both">&#8212;-</p>
<p style="clear: both">TuneUp cleans your tracks by fixing your mislabeled music and missing coverarts. The app adds a new sidebar to iTunes with all the tools you need to use to clean up your music. The now playing tab displays information about the track and even lets you play the music video of the track right in the sidebar (video fetched from YouTube). TuneUp was really buggy when it first launches late last year due to the overwhelming response but I guess they should have cleared out the kinks by now. <a title="TuneUp" href="http://www.suberapps.com/2008/12/13/tuneup-companion-10-for-itunes-should-you-install/" target="_blank">Read more about TuneUp</a> in a review written in December last year.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
YouControl</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[Free | <a title="YouControl" href="http://www.yousoftware.com/tunes/tunes.php"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/youcontrol-thumb.png" alt="" width="576" height="262"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">You Control basically lets you control your iTunes music library via your menubar without switching to iTunes.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
DockArt</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[Free | <a title="DockArt" href="http://homepage.mac.com/gweston/dockart/"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/dockart-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="152" align="left" /><br style="clear: both" />DockArt does a simple but extremely useful job by replacing the default iTunes icon in your dock with the currently playing music&#8217;s coverart. When you stop your music, your iTunes icon reverts back to the original one.</p>
<p style="clear: both">
<h2><strong><br />
AutoRate</strong></h2>
<p style="clear: both">[Free | <a title="AutoRate" href="http://tzisoftware.com/products/autorate" target="_blank">Website</a>]</p>
<p style="clear: both"><img style=" display: inline; float: left; margin: 0 10px 10px 0;" src="http://www.suberapps.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/autorate-thumb.png" alt="" width="586" height="288" align="left" /></p>
<p style="clear: both">AutoRate automatically rates your tracks based on how often the track is played and how often each track is skipped. Might not be the most accurate, but a good start if you are not really active in rating your music.</p>
